Understanding Spleen Deficiency
Before we jump into the solutions, let’s quickly understand what spleen deficiency is. In TCM, the spleen is considered a vital organ responsible for digestion and the transformation of food into energy. When the spleen is weak, it can lead to symptoms like fatigue, poor appetite, bloating, and loose stools. 🍽️
Qu Li Min’s Top Tips for Quick Recovery
Qu Li Min emphasizes a holistic approach to treating spleen deficiency. Here are her top tips to help you recover faster:
1. Adjust Your Diet 🍽️
One of the most effective ways to strengthen the spleen is through diet. Qu Li Min recommends eating warm, cooked foods that are easy to digest. Think soups, stews, and steamed vegetables. Avoid cold, raw, and greasy foods, as they can further weaken the spleen. 🥗
2. Herbal Remedies 🍃
TCM offers a variety of herbs to support spleen health. Qu Li Min suggests using herbs like Astragalus (Huang Qi), Codonopsis (Dang Shen), and White Atractylodes (Bai Zhu). These herbs can be added to your meals or brewed as tea to enhance your digestive function. 🍵
3. Lifestyle Changes 🏃♀️
Stress and overwork can exacerbate spleen deficiency. Qu Li Min advises incorporating relaxation techniques such as meditation, yoga, and gentle exercise into your daily routine. Taking time to unwind and recharge can do wonders for your overall health. 🧘♂️
